We understand why fast food chains would try to jump on the food hybrid trend, but Jack In The Box has officially taken it too far. According to Brand Eating, the fast food giant is currently testing a Chick-N-Tater Melt, which features some kind of take on a typical melt-style sandwich, except with a croissant bun. We're not even sure that counts as a mash-up.
The "Munchie Meal" (does that means this it's supposed to be a snack?!) features a fried chicken patty, a hash brown patty, bacon, Swiss cheese, cheese sauce, and ranch. It also comes with two tacos, fries, and a drink for $6. The testing phase is currently taking place at San Jose, California-area locations as part of Jack In The Box's late-night menu, which also includes a grilled cheese bun burger.
